Output 21bde8112199820b8bd7955dd9fb2e2312bb2b0bc8a628d18ebc586bd7f26ba7:1

value
48428527
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 520f6421672825eb048b98bd37f35af44e9130b8 OP_EQUALVERIFY OP_CHECKSIG
address
18Utr8F6ejq42suBWd9sLKqf1iXLseixT6
transaction
21bde8112199820b8bd7955dd9fb2e2312bb2b0bc8a628d18ebc586bd7f26ba7
spent
true